St. Peter’s Community Arts Academy will host a night of song, supper, and support with its Spring Sing and Pulled Pork BBQ Picnic on Friday, June 6, at St. Peter’s Church and Parish Hall at 149 Genesee Street.
The evening begins with a picnic dinner from 5:30 to 7:00 p.m. featuring pulled pork, macaroni salad, coleslaw, lemonade, and dessert for $17. A kid’s meal of a hot dog, sides, and dessert will be available for $10. Guests are encouraged to purchase tickets in advance by June 1.
The festivities continue with the Spring Sing Concert at 7:30 p.m. inside the church sanctuary. The concert is free and will showcase four of the academy’s choirs performing a spirited lineup of choral works.
All proceeds from the dinner benefit the academy’s Tour Choir, helping young vocalists continue their musical education and represent Geneva in regional performances.
In addition, the academy is gearing up for its “Huge, Massive, GIGANTIC Lawn Sale” on Saturday, June 14, from 9:00 a.m. to 1:00 p.m., also at 149 Genesee Street. Donations of gently used items—excluding books and clothing—are being accepted through June 12 to support the choir program.
